Occupational Therapist Case Worker

Alliance Norse is currently recruiting for an Occupational Therapist Case Worker to join the team on a full time permanent basis, 40 hours per week Monday to Friday.

As the Case Worker, you will be responsible for acting as first port of call when clients contact us to access our services.

Case managers are trained to first provide a telephone triage call to understand the caller’s needs and explain how our DFG services work.

The role

  • Take calls from clients seeking to access Alliance Norse DFG services
  • Ask them for the relevant information and put it on Alliance Norse database application (ELMs)
  • Match the client with the appropriate practitioner, including contacting the practitioner for their availability.
  • Liaise between the practitioner and the client to arrange the initial appointment.
  • Send confirmation emails to clients and practitioners regarding first appointments.
  • Refer any ‘at risk’ cases to the appropriate clinical manager or safeguarding member of staff.
  • Become familiar with Alliance Norse’s DFG services, procedures and processes in order to support Reception staff when necessary.
  • Deal with enquiries from clients regarding the administration side of their therapy and answer any queries they have.
  • Support the finance team with regard to client fees when necessary.
  • Provide liaison with GPs, solicitors, employers, occupational health and medical insurance companies regarding referrals when applicable.
  • Liaise with other professionals and referrers as well as parents and families when required.
  • Collect feedback from clients and put it on Alliance Norse database application.
  • Support practitioners in the use of Alliance Norse database drive to enable them to use our electronic systems for all record keeping.
